.223 for 1000 yard F-class help !

Want to make-up .223 for shooting F-class in Canada max bullet weight allowed 80gr.
I have a 40xb Rem action,Jewell Trigger, Scope nightforce benchrest 8by32by56mm

Barrel;lenght,28,29 30" ?? make you would recomend,

Twist:7,7.5 8 ??

Most fellows are using 80gr Sierra,s MK ??

powders of choice seems to be Varget ??

any advise would be nice.
 
There are Many options out there to try. I use Hornady 75 Amax bullets with around 24-24.4 grains of either RL15 or Vihtavuori N530. 1/8" twist works perfect. You may wany to try a Lilja 3 groove bbl. You might get a bit more velocity with the Lilja and you need every bit of velocity that you can get @ 1k with a 223. Get at least a 28" bbl. If you are concerned with weight limit, get a medium Palma contour and you will be able to go up to 32" for your F-class rifle. Although..my experience tells me that after around 29", the velocity increase with a 223 is minimal.

I shoot a .223 in fullbore prone and it is more accurate than my 308 palma guns. I use 7 and 8 twist bbls with the 1-7/30" Krieger the most accurate a 1K. Try 25.xg R-15 and the 80g AMax. I can run 3100 with this bullet and it seems to use less windage than the palma bullets. Best of luck to you. -lige
 
I can't see how you could beat the speed of N550. I run an 80gr. berger out of a 24" Rock barrel and easily reach 3k fps. There was an article about reaching 3k fps in a service rifle in PS a couple of years ago. N550 was the winner.

A long chamber throat will be the key as you will want at least 2.5"COAL.
